Job Description
Veeam, the leader in data protection and ransomware recovery, is seeking a Backend Engineer to join its Veeam Data Cloud (VDC) engineering team. The ideal candidate will work with a global team to build next-generation data protection services focused on data resilience. This role offers the opportunity to work on greenfield projects, developing features from the ground up for worldwide deployment.
The role involves:
- Designing and developing reliable, scalable, and globally available cloud services for data protection.
- Participating in technical design discussions, code reviews, and providing feedback.
- Ensuring high-quality, thoroughly tested, and secure code.
- Taking ownership of reliability and efficiency of services running in the cloud.
- Participating in on-call rotation for product operations.
Requirements:
- 5+ years of experience in software development.
- Expertise in a modern programming language (Java, Go, Scala, or Rust).
- Strong computer science fundamentals (data structures, algorithms, concurrency).
- Experience designing, building, and implementing core features in production services or software.
- Experience developing, testing, and debugging production-quality, scalable, multithreaded, concurrent systems.
- Passion for code quality, extensibility, coding standards, testing, and automation.
Veeam offers:
- Family Medical Insurance
- Annual flexible spending allowance for health and well-being
- Life insurance
- Personal accident insurance
- Employee Assistance Program
- A comprehensive leave package, including parental leave
- Meal Benefit Pass
- Transportation Allowance
- Daycare/Child care Allowance
- Veeam Care Days – additional 24 hours for your volunteering activities
- Professional training and education
Veeam Software
Veeam Software is the global leader in data protection and ransomware recovery, empowering organizations to achieve radical resilience. Its Veeam Data Platform delivers a single solution for hybrid cloud environments, including cloud, virtual, physical, SaaS, and Kubernetes. Veeam provides data security, data recovery, and data freedom, ensuring applications and data are protected and always available. Serving over 450,000 customers worldwide, with a significant presence among the Global 2000, Veeam is headquartered in Seattle and operates in over 30 countries. They are also the leader in Kubernetes Backup and Disaster Recovery.